Output 67c1093fa86ad1e6144bc153f6ce3773233376e17230c3069c1d80cec9526240:0

value
434857368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1df8ee38d0a8b8dbf4a48799a9b33d42c77ed632 OP_EQUAL
address
34RVj73PvCAiRhzTLKPMwg8nw5MUWKDhvE
transaction
67c1093fa86ad1e6144bc153f6ce3773233376e17230c3069c1d80cec9526240
spent
true